チュートリアル プルリクエストを使ってみよう レビューとマージ

Backlog編かGitHub編を選んでください。

Backlog編

画面上から差分のチェックとレビュー

レビュー担当者は「ファイル」タブから変更内容を確認できます。

修正してほしい箇所がある場合、ソースコードにコメントできます。マウスオーバーした時に対象の行に表示されるプラスボタンをクリックします。

修正してほしい内容とお知らせしたいユーザを入力し「登録」をクリックします。

入力したコメントは、ソースコード中にインラインで埋め込まれると同時に、「コメント」タブにも転記されます。

レビュー内容の反映

レビュー内容に沿ってソースコードを修正します。

sort.jsvar sortNumber = function (number) {
number.sort(function (a, b) {
if (a === b) {
return 0;
}
return a < b ? -1 : 1;
});
};

var number = [19, 3, 81, 1, 24, 21];
sortNumber(number);
console.log(number);

修正が完了したので、再度コミットとプッシュを行います。

$ git add sort.js
$ git commit -m "厳密等価演算子(===)を使用するように修正"
$ git push origin add-sort-func

修正した旨を伝えるために、先ほど作成したプルリクエストにコメントしましょう。

「コメント」もしくは「コミット履歴」タブから、修正されたコミットを確認できます。また「ファイル」タブでは、修正分のコミットを含めた全コミットが含まれた状態で差分表示されます。

GitHub編

画面上から差分のチェックとレビュー

レビュー担当者は「Files changed」タブから変更内容を確認できます。

修正してほしい箇所がある場合、ソースコードにコメントできます。マウスオーバーした時に対象の行に表示されるプラスボタンをクリックします。

修正してほしい内容を入力し「Comment」ボタンをクリックします。

入力したコメントは、ソースコード中にインラインで埋め込まれると同時に、「Conversation」タブにも転記されます。

レビュー内容の反映

レビュー内容に沿ってソースコードを修正します。

sort.jsvar sortNumber = function (number) {
number.sort(function (a, b) {
if (a === b) {
return 0;
}
return a < b ? -1 : 1;
});
};

var number = [19, 3, 81, 1, 24, 21];
sortNumber(number);
console.log(number);

修正が完了したので、再度コミットとプッシュを行います。

$ git add sort.js
$ git commit -m "厳密等価演算子(===)を使用するように修正"
$ git push origin add-sort-func

修正した旨を伝えるために、先ほど作成したプルリクエストにコメントしましょう。

「Conversation」もしくは「Commits」タブから、修正されたコミットを確認できます。また「Files Changed」タブでは、修正分のコミットを含めた全コミットが含まれた状態で差分表示されます。